Wedding Booking Terms & Conditions

Non-Exclusive Use Weddings we require an initial non-refundable/non transferable deposit of £1,000, with a further payment £1000 non refundable/non transferable payment due four months later. With 50% of your estimated total bill due 6 months prior to the wedding date. The final balance of your wedding is due strictly 6 weeks prior to your wedding date, together with final guest numbers.
Non exclusive use weddings are contracted to a minimum booking of 6 bedrooms this includes the complimentary bridal room (if applicable) and are allocated by the Hotel. Those bedrooms must be booked by yourselves or your guests, if bedrooms have not been booked and paid for they will be part of your final wedding payment. To book any extra bedrooms a £50.00 deposit per room per night is required at time of booking as we are not able to hold rooms provisionally, the £50 deposits are non refundable non transferable, Rushton Hall reserves the right to move guests bedrooms attending a wedding closer to function room so as to limit the disturbance to hotel guests not attending the wedding.

At the time of your final meeting, if any of these allocated rooms have not been booked, the charge for these rooms will be added onto your final bill for you to settle in full.

For exclusive use weddings the non-refundable/non transferable deposit required is £3,000, a further £3,000 non refundable non transferable payment is due four months later, with 50% of your estimated total bill will be requested 6 months prior. The final balance of your wedding is due strictly six weeks prior to your wedding date, together with final guest numbers.

Our spa is not included in the Exclusive Use fee due to this being on a membership basis. Front gates cannot be closed during Exclusive Use Weddings, as these provide access to other properties.

For exclusive use weddings bedrooms must be allocated by the bride & groom at your earliest convenience so as additional nights (night prior bedrooms) can be reserved in the correct rooms.

Minimum numbers for Saturday weddings is 80 adults and minimum numbers for Friday & Sunday weddings is 60 adults.

Exclusive use weddings – Great Hall for wedding breakfast is always minimum numbers of 80 adults on any day of the week all year.

For non exclusive weddings there is a minimum number of 80 adult guests for the Pavilion. Final numbers must be confirmed to Rushton Hall one month in advance of the wedding. Numbers may only be reduced by up to 10% from that stated on the contract but not below the minimum numbers.

For non exclusive weddings the latest time for dining is 4.30pm. For Sunday special wedding package the earliest time for dining is 5.30pm. Speeches must take place after the meal.

You may arrange to taste your wedding menu in advance, but only within 3 months of your wedding date. This can be done Monday to Thursday at 7.00pm, however if the Sirloin of Scotch Air Dryed Beef is on your menu choice this can only be available on a Sunday lunch. The cost is that of the actual wedding menu you are trying on a per person basis plus any drinks/wine and must be paid for in full on departure from the Hotel after your tasting. The food tasting is for the main wedding breakfast courses only and not the evening buffets or canapés. House wines can be tasted, full glasses and bottles will be charged accordingly, other wines will be charged by the bottle.

We recommend you engage the services of a Master of Ceremonies. We can arrange one on your behalf at a cost of £260.00. However if you decide you do not require his services, much of the organisation during the Wedding Breakfast will be your responsibility. You will need to remember to organise the line up to receive your guests, announce the speeches, decide when the presents need to be passed, when the cake should be cut, etc. A Master of Ceremonies booked by the hotel only will be free of charge if a minimum of 100 guests is reached for the Wedding Breakfast. If you agree to book this service and cancel within 6 months of your Wedding date a fee of £125.00 will be chargeable regardless of whether this was orginally included complimentary or not.

The check-in time for hotel rooms is strictly from 3.00pm. All rooms must be vacated by 11.00 am the following day. Therefore, please take this into consideration should you or any of your guests need to get ready at the hotel, staying the night prior is the only way to guarantee that this is possible. If you wish for the bridal party to get ready at the hotel, you would be required to book the allocated bridal room for the night prior, to ensure that this is possible. You will be responsible for booking rooms yourselves at the earliest possible convenience. Rushton Hall will not take responsibility for contacting you regarding other bookings being taken which may result in all accommodation being booked. All room bookings are subject to availability.

The evening buffet is compulsory when additional evening guests are invited and we will cater for the total number of guests attending. Serving time is between 9.30-10.00pm.
